⚠️ Travel Update
Planning to visit the Grand Palace? Please plan accordingly!

🙏The Grand Palace and the Temple of the Emerald Buddha will be closed from 13 to 19 June 2026 for the royal merit-making ceremonies dedicated to Her Royal Highness Princess Bajrakitiyabha Narendiradebyavati Krom Luang Rajasarinisiribajra Mahavajrarajadhita at the Grand Palace.

🌈 Get ready for BANGKOK PRIDE PARADE 2026: Patch the World with Peace People Pride 🌈

Join the grandest parade of the year to celebrate our power and pride on Silom Road. This year, we express our journey through 6 unique parades:
💚 Green (Nararom Intersection): Patch of Harmony – The heart of peace and quality of life.
💙 Blue (Soi Thaniya): Patch of Unity – The power of safety and a home for all identities.
💜 Purple (Political Science, Chula): Patch of Identity – Dignified Gender Recognition.
🧡 Orange (Faculty of Arts, Chula): Patch of Dignity – Valuing all professions and labor equally.
❤️ Red (Siam Paragon): Patch of Love – Equal rights for all family structures.
💛 Yellow (Lido): Patch of Spirit – Connecting people through arts and culture.
All parades will head to Thephasadin Stadium to celebrate on the PRIDE STAGE, featuring the "Rabiab Vatasilp" band and many LGBTQIAN+ icons!
📅 Sunday, May 31, 2026
🕰️ 2 PM onwards
📍 Route: Silom Road —> Thephasadin Stadium
